متد وضعیت ارسال در API نوتیفیکیشن؛ تحلیل دقیق نرخ کلیک و تحویل

شکل
شکل
شکل
شکل
شکل
شکل
شکل
شکل
متد وضعیت ارسال در API نوتیفیکیشن؛ تحلیل دقیق نرخ کلیک و تحویل

راهنمای جامع API نوتیفیکیشن: متد بررسی وضعیت ارسال نوتیفیکیشن

در دنیای دیجیتال مارکتینگ و توسعه اپلیکیشن، ارسال پیام به کاربر تنها نیمی از مسیر است. نیمه دوم و مهم‌تر، اطمینان از رسیدن پیام و تحلیل رفتار کاربر است. اگر از وب‌سرویس پوش نوتیفیکیشن استفاده می‌کنید، باید بدانید که متد بررسی وضعیت ارسال، کلیدی‌ترین بخش برای سنجش نرخ موفقیت کمپین‌های شماست. در این مقاله، به بررسی دقیق API نوتیفیکیشن متد وضعیت ارسال نوتیفیکیشن می‌پردازیم. 🚀

چرا بررسی وضعیت ارسال نوتیفیکیشن حیاتی است؟

پس از اجرای متد ارسال که در مقالات قبلی به آن پرداختیم، شما نیاز دارید بدانید چه تعداد از پیام‌های شما به دست کاربران رسیده (Delivered) و چه تعداد باز شده‌اند (Opened). API نوتیفیکیشن متد وضعیت ارسال نوتیفیکیشن به شما این امکان را می‌دهد که داده‌های خام را به استراتژی‌های بازاریابی تبدیل کنید. بدون این متد، شما در حال حرکت در تاریکی هستید. 💡

مزیت‌های استفاده از متد وضعیت ارسال

استفاده از این API مزایای متعددی برای توسعه‌دهندگان و مدیران محصول دارد:

  • 📊 تحلیل دقیق داده‌ها: دسترسی به آمار لحظه‌ای از تعداد پیام‌های ارسالی و دریافتی.
  • 🎯 بهبود نرخ تعامل (CTR): با مقایسه وضعیت‌های مختلف، می‌توانید محتوای جذاب‌تری تولید کنید.
  • 🛠️ عیب‌یابی سریع: اگر نرخ تحویل پایین باشد، متوجه اختلال در توکن‌ها یا زیرساخت خواهید شد.
  • 💰 بهینه‌سازی هزینه‌ها: جلوگیری از ارسال پیام به کاربران غیرفعال بر اساس گزارش‌های دریافتی.

مشخصات فنی و نحوه فراخوانی API

برای دریافت وضعیت یک پوش خاص، از متد GET استفاده می‌شود. این متد با دریافت شناسه اپلیکیشن و شناسه پیام، جزئیات کامل آن را برمی‌گرداند.

ساختار آدرس (Endpoint)

آدرس اصلی برای ارسال درخواست به شرح زیر است:

GET: https://api.cheshmak.me/v1/push/app/[AppId]/status/[PushId]

  • AppId: شناسه منحصر‌به‌فرد اپلیکیشن شما.
  • PushId: شناسه‌ای که بلافاصله پس از ارسال موفق پوش دریافت کرده‌اید.

نمونه دستور CURL

برای تست سریع وب‌سرویس می‌توانید از دستور زیر استفاده کنید:

bash
curl -X GET \
-H "key: YOUR_API_KEY" \
-H "Cache-Control: no-cache" \
"https://api.cheshmak.me/v1/push/app/YOUR_APP_ID/status/YOUR_PUSH_ID"

تحلیل خروجی (Response) و مفاهیم آن

خروجی این API برخلاف لیست کلی پیام‌ها، یک شیء (Object) واحد شامل فیلدهای زیر است:

فیلدتوضیحات
sentCountتعداد کل پیام‌های ارسال شده از سمت سرور
deliveredCountتعداد پیام‌هایی که با موفقیت روی گوشی کاربر نشسته است
openedCountتعداد دفعاتی که کاربران روی نوتیفیکیشن کلیک کرده‌اند
statusوضعیت نهایی (مانند done به معنای پایان عملیات)

📝 نکته سئو: درک تفاوت بین sentCount و deliveredCount برای بهینه‌سازی فنی اپلیکیشن بسیار ضروری است.

کاربردهای عملی API وضعیت ارسال

این متد تنها برای نمایش آمار نیست، بلکه کاربردهای گسترده‌ای در اتوماسیون دارد:

  • 📱 مانیتورینگ زنده: نمایش نمودار رشد در پنل مدیریت اختصاصی خودتان.
  • 🔄 ارسال مجدد هوشمند: اگر پیام به دست کاربر نرسید، می‌توانید از طریق کانال‌های دیگر (مانند SMS) اقدام کنید.
  • 🧪 تست A/B: بررسی اینکه کدام عنوان (Title) منجر به openedCount بالاتری شده است.

متد وضعیت ارسال در API نوتیفیکیشن؛ تحلیل دقیق نرخ کلیک و تحویل

راهنمای سریع ثبت‌نام و شروع کار

اگر هنوز از خدمات هوشمند نوتیفیکیشن استفاده نکرده‌اید، همین حالا شروع کنید. مراحل زیر بسیار ساده هستند:

  1. 🌐 به وب‌سایت اصلی مراجعه کنید.
  2. 📧 حساب کاربری خود را با ایمیل معتبر ایجاد نمایید.
  3. 🔑 کد API اختصاصی خود را از پنل دریافت کنید.
  4. 🔗 برای شروع سریع و دریافت اعتبار اولیه، از طریق لینک p.api.ir اقدام به ثبت‌نام نمایید.

جمع‌بندی و گام بعدی

در این مقاله با API نوتیفیکیشن متد وضعیت ارسال نوتیفیکیشن آشنا شدیم و آموختیم چگونه با تحلیل داده‌های delivered و opened کمپین‌های موفق‌تری اجرا کنیم. به یاد داشته باشید که خواندن داده‌ها، اولین قدم برای رشد کسب‌وکار شماست. ✅

آیا در پیاده‌سازی این متد با خطایی مواجه شده‌اید؟ سوالات یا تجربیات خود را در بخش نظرات با ما در میان بگذارید تا کارشناسان ما شما را راهنمایی کنند. همچنین پیشنهاد می‌کنیم مقاله بعدی ما درباره «بهینه‌سازی زمان ارسال پوش نوتیفیکیشن» را از دست ندهید.

دیدگاهتان را بنویسید

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*